The Atlanta chapter of the Association of Health Care Journalists held a social gathering Dec. 10 at the Emory Conference Center Hotel, gathering with the 2013-14 Regional Health Journalism Fellows, who were in town for their visit to the CDC.

Twelve local health journalists and guests shared stories about the Affordable Care Act with fellows from states that, unlike Georgia, are running their own insurance exchanges and are expanding their Medicaid programs under the ACA.

The fellows discussed their tour of the CDC and the presentations that the federal agency gave. Mike King, former health/science editor at The Atlanta Journal-Constitution, spoke of how the CDC has grown from a relatively small operation in the 1980s.

AHCJ Executive Director Len Bruzzese and Training Coordinator Ev Ruch-Graham also attended the event.

The Atlanta chapter hopes to have another event soon after New Year’s.
